NOACC
Incorporated in 1995, the Northern Ohio Area Chambers of Commerce (NOACC) was established to provide tangible benefits of chamber membership to local businesses. NOACC has now grown to over 120 chambers of commerce–some volunteer managed, some county-wide in scope–and some of the NOACC chambers have grown ten-fold with the adoption of these benefits.
Medina Chamber of Commerce
The Greater Medina Chamber of Commerce is a voluntary organization of the business community. The Chamber is a not-for-profit, taxpaying organization. It unites hundreds of business and professional firms, thus creating a unique central agency working to improve business and build a better community. The Chamber membership includes business from sole proprietors to companies with over 500 members.
